The Terror is an AMC original anthology series that examines the nature of horror in extreme situations. The first season of the series follows a British Royal Navy expedition that disappeared while exploring for the Northwest Passage in 1845. The second season of the series, named "Infamy", follows a Japanese-American community who discovers that they are being haunted by a supernatural force during their time at an internment camp at the height of World War II. The series, which is being executive produced by Ridley Scott, premiered its first season in the US in March of 2018 on the AMC television network.
